About

Porth Dafarch Beach on Anglesey offers families a sheltered cove on the island's dramatic western coastline. This outdoor beach in Wales welcomes visitors of all ages from babies and toddlers to teenagers for seaside activities. The beach features toilet facilities, baby changing amenities and pushchair friendly access where terrain allows.

Families can enjoy swimming in the sheltered bay, exploring rock pools and relaxing on the sandy shore. The clear waters make this a popular spot for snorkelling and kayaking. Located on Anglesey, this beach provides beautiful Welsh coastal experiences.
